Flat 36, Parkside, 193 Hart Road, Manchester, M14 7BA is a leasehold flat built between 1996-2002. The property offers approximately 635 square feet of living space and is situated on the 3rd floor. In this location, apartments of similar size usually have one bedroom.

The estimated current market value of the property is £186,108 , which equates to approximately £293 per square foot. It was last sold on 9 Sep 2024 for £181,000. Since then, the value has increased by £5,108, representing a 2.8% increase, or approximately 2.2% per year.

The current estimated value of £186,108 is:

  • 37.1% lower than the average property price on Hart Road
  • 22.9% lower than the average in the M14 7BA postcode area
  • and 49.1% lower than the average price for Manchester as a whole

EPC Summary

Flat 36, Parkside, 193 Hart Road, Manchester, Greater Manchester, M14 7BA has an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) rating of C, based on the latest assessment carried out on 18 Aug 2020.

This property uses electric storage heaters as its main heating source. Hot water is provided from off-peak electric immersion heater. The windows are fully double glazed.

The previous EPC assessment was conducted on 15 Mar 2010. The rating of C is unchanged, though the energy efficiency score decreased by 10%.

Since the previous assessment, several changes were observed:

  • The main heating energy efficiency improving from poor to average, while the heating system type remained the same (electric storage heaters).
  • The roof construction or insulation changed from pitched, 300+ mm loft insulation to pitched, 100 mm loft insulation, changing energy efficiency from very good to average.
  • The wall construction or insulation changed from cavity wall, as built, insulated (assumed) to timber frame, as built, insulated (assumed), with no change in energy efficiency (good).
  • The lighting was updated from no low energy lighting to low energy lighting in 57% of fixed outlets, with efficiency improving from very poor to good.
